【技术实现步骤摘要】
通话方法及电子设备
[0001]本申请实施例涉及终端
,尤其涉及一种通话方法及电子设备。
技术介绍
[0002]在分布式系统中,多个电子设备之间能够实现协同工作。比如,电子设备(如手机,平板等),通过无线通信技术,能够利用蓝牙耳机等可穿戴设备实现音频数据的采集和播放,方便用户操作。又比如,电子设备利用投屏技术,将本地显示屏显示内容通过无线通信技术发送至大屏设备进行显示,方便用户观看。
[0003]但是,在上述两个场景中,电子设备之间只能进行单一的音频数据或者视频数据传输实现协同工作,无法适用于目前视频通话过程中,音频数据和视频数据同步实时传输的场景。并且,只能按照固定规则选择协同工作的电子设备,忽略无线连接的稳定性,影响用户使用体验。
技术实现思路
[0004]本申请实施例提供的通话方法及电子设备,参与通话过程的分布式设备将各自具有的能力进行划分并进行注册。在通话过程中,能够根据已注册的能力选择最适用的能力对应的设备处理通话业务,提高用户使用体验。
[0005]为达到上述目的,本申请实施 ...
【技术保护点】
【技术特征摘要】
1.一种通话方法,其特征在于,应用于第一设备,所述方法包括:建立与至少一个第二设备的通信连接;接收所述至少一个第二设备的能力的注册信息;接收第一通话业务请求;根据所述第一设备的能力信息以及所述至少一个第二设备的能力的注册信息,选择用于处理所述第一通话业务请求的第一目标设备;所述第一目标设备为所述第一设备或所述至少一个第二设备中的一个设备;发送所述第一通话业务请求至所述第一目标设备;接收所述第一目标设备对处理所述第一通话业务请求的第一反馈信息。2.根据权利要求1所述的方法,其特征在于,所述根据所述第一设备的能力信息以及所述至少一个第二设备的能力的注册信息,选择用于处理所述第一通话业务请求的第一目标设备,包括:根据所述第一设备的能力信息以及所述至少一个第二设备的能力的注册信息,将所述第一设备的能力和所述第二设备的能力按照功能类别进行分组,设置每一组别对应的评价指标以及每一评价指标对应的权重;选择用于处理所述第一通话业务请求的第一组别,利用所述评价指标和所述评价指标对应的权重,对所述第一组别中的所述第一设备的能力和/或所述第二设备的能力进行评分,选择所述第一目标设备,所述第一目标设备在所述第一组别中的能力的评分为最高评分。3.根据权利要求1或2所述的方法,其特征在于,在接收所述第一目标设备对处理所述第一通话业务请求的第一反馈信息之后,所述方法还包括:根据所述第一反馈信息,确定第二通话业务请求;所述第二通话业务请求不同于所述第一通话业务请求;根据所述第一设备的能力信息以及所述至少一个第二设备的能力的注册信息,选择用于处理所述第二通话业务请求的第二目标设备;所述第二目标设备为所述第一设备或所述至少一个第二设备中的一个设备;发送所述第二通话业务请求至所述第二目标设备;接收所述第二目标设备对处理所述第二通话业务请求的第二反馈信息。4.根据权利要求3所述的方法,其特征在于,所述第一目标设备与所述第二目标设备为不同的第二设备,所述第一目标设备用于直接接收所述第二目标设备发送的通话数据。5.根据权利要求1所述的方法,其特征在于,所述接收第一通话业务请求之后,所述方法还包括:根据所述第一通话业务请求,选择与所述第一通话业务请求关联的所述第一目标设备。6.根据权利要求1
‑
5任一项所述的方法,其特征在于,所述第一设备与所述至少一个第二设备中的至少一个第二设备之间的设备形态不同。7.根据权利要求1
‑
6任一项所述的方法,其特征在于,所述第一设备的能力信息的数量为一个或多个,同一个第二设备的能力的注册信息的数量为一个或多个。8.根据权利要求1
‑
7任一项所述的方法,其特征在于,所述第一通话业务请求为号码解
析请求、号码拨打请求、视频播放和/或采集请求、音频播放和/或采集请求中的任一项。9.根据权利要求1
‑
8任一项所述的方法,其特征在于,所述第一目标设备为所述第一设备,所述发送所述第一通话业务请求至所述第一目标设备,接收所述第一目标设备对处理所述第一通话业务请求的第一反馈信息,包括:所述第一目标设备中的第一模块发送所述第一通话业务请求至所述第一目标设备中的第二模块;所述第一模块接收所述第二模块对处理所述第一通话业务请求的所述第一反馈信息。10.根据权利要求1
‑
8任一项所述的方法,其特征在于,所述第一目标设备为所述至少一个第二设备中的目标第二设备,所述发送所述第一通话业务请求至所述第一目标设备,接收所述第一目标设备对处理所述第一通话业务请求的第一反馈信息,包括:所述第一设备发送所述第一通话业务请求至所述目标第二设备;所述第一设备接收所述目标第二设备对处理所述第一通话业务请求的所述第一反馈信息。11.一种电子设备,其特征在于,包括:处理器和存储器,所述存储器与所述处理器耦合,所述存储器用于存储计算机程序代码,所述计算机程序代码包括计算机指令,当所述处理器从所述存储器中读取所述计算机指令,使得所述电子设备执行如下操作:建立与至少一个第二设备的通信连接;接收所述至少一个第二设备的能力的注册信息...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。